Chakol-e Zolbarī
Chakol-e Zolbarī is a mountain in Semnan Province, Iran and has an elevation of 2,176 metres. Chakol-e Zolbarī is situated nearby to the locality Abarsij, as well as near Sīāh Kamar.- Type: Mountain with an elevation of 2,176 metres
- Description: mountain in Iran
- Also known as: “Chakol Zolbarī”, “Kuh-e Sar Eskand”, and “Kūh-e Sar Eskand”
